    About Albanian language

    See more about Albanian language in here.

    Albanian (/ælˈbeɪniən/; shqip [ʃcip] or gjuha shqipe [ˈɟuha ˈʃcipɛ]) is an Indo-European language spoken by the Albanians in the Balkans and the Albanian diaspora in the Americas, Europe and Oceania. With about 7.5 million speakers, it comprises an independent branch within the Indo-European languages and is not closely related to any other language..

    Writing system in Albanian

    Latin (Albanian alphabet), Albanian Braille.

    Albanian Speaking Countries and Territories

    Albanian Speaking Countries and Territories: Albania, Kosovo, Greece, Italy, Montenegro, North Macedonia, Serbia.
